14.1% of Gardner, IL residents had an income below the poverty level in 2022, which was 15.4% greater than the poverty level of 11.9% across the entire state of Illinois. 10.2% of high school graduates and 27.9% of non high school graduates live in poverty. The poverty rate was 22.4% among disabled residents. The renting rate among poor residents was 65.6%. For comparison, it was 6.7% among residents with income above the poverty level.
